Antique Japanese Bronze Water Bowl

About the Item

Antique Japanese bronze water bowl. Beautiful water bowl and patina. Hand-Crafted Design. Mid Meiji 1868 - 1912. Bowl top diameter 24 1/2". Bowl height 13 1/4".
